Table 37: LT3CPDIF Group settings (advanced)
Name Values (Range) Unit Step Default Description
EndSection1 0.20 - 1.50 IB 0.01 1.25 End of section 1, as multiple of reference
current IBase
EndSection2 1.00 - 10.00 IB 0.01 3.00 End of section 2, as multiple of reference
current IBase
SlopeSection2 10.0 - 50.0 % 0.1 40.0 Slope in section 2 of operate-restrain
characteristic, in %
SlopeSection3 30.0 - 100.0 % 0.1 80.0 Slope in section 3 of operate- restrain
characteristic, in %
I2/I1Ratio 5.0 - 100.0 % 1.0 10.0 Max. ratio of 2nd harm. to fundamental
harm dif. curr. in %
I5/I1Ratio 5.0 - 100.0 % 1.0 25.0 Max. ratio of 5th harm. to fundamental
harm dif. curr. in %
p 0.01 - 1000.00 - 0.01 0.02 Settable curve parameter, user-
programmable curve type.
a 0.01 - 1000.00 - 0.01 0.14 Settable curve parameter, user-
programmable curve type.
b 0.01 - 1000.00 - 0.01 1.00 Settable curve parameter, user-
programmable curve type.
c 0.01 - 1000.00 - 0.01 1.00 Settable curve parameter, user-
programmable curve type.
OpenCTEnable Off
On
- - On Open CTEnable Off/On
tOCTAlarmDelay 0.100 - 10.000 s 0.001 1.000 Open CT: time in s to alarm after an
open CT is detected
tOCTResetDelay 0.100 - 10.000 s 0.001 0.250 Reset delay in s. After delay, diff.
function is activated
OCTBlockEn Off
On
- - On Enable Open CT blocking function trip
Off/On
Table 38: LT3CPDIF Non group settings (basic)
Name
Values (Range) Unit Step Default Description
GlobalBaseSel 1 - 12 - 1 1 Selection of one of the Global Base
Value groups
NoOfUsedCTs 2
3
- - 2 Total number of 3-Ph CT sets connected
to diff protection
ZerSeqCurSubtr Off
On
- - Off Off/On for elimination of zero seq. from
diff. and bias curr
